The Role of Link Building in Modern SEO
Link building is the procedure of obtaining hyperlinks from other sites to one's own. For online search engine like Google, these links serve as "votes of confidence." If established, reliable sites connect to a page, it indicates to search engines that the material is important and trustworthy.

Nevertheless, the quality of these links has ended up being even more crucial than the amount. Modern algorithms are developed to discover manipulative "link plans," making it vital for firms to concentrate on white-hat techniques that offer long-term stability and development.
Core Link Building Strategies Used by Agencies
Professional companies use a range of techniques to secure high-quality placements. Below are the most efficient methods presently utilized in the market.
1. Digital PR and Media Outreach
This is the gold requirement of link structure. It includes developing data-driven stories, infographics, or professional commentary that reporters wish to point out. The outcome is typically a link from a significant news outlet or industry publication with enormous authority.
2. Guest Posting and Thought Leadership

3. The Skyscraper Technique
popularized by Brian Dean, this method includes recognizing "linkable assets" in a specific niche, creating something significantly much better (more current, better created, or more comprehensive), and connecting to sites that connected to the initial version to recommend they link to the enhanced one.
4. Broken Link Building
This technical method involves discovering 404 mistake pages on relevant sites, determining the content that used to be there, and using the web designer a replacement link to a live, pertinent page on the customer's website.
5. Niche Edits (Link Insertions)
Agencies typically reach out to web designers to add a link to an existing, well-indexed post. This works due to the fact that the page currently has historic authority and traffic.

Normally, it takes between 3 to 6 months to see a considerable influence on rankings. This timeline depends on the competitiveness of the industry and the existing authority of the website.
2. Is it better to build few high-authority links or many low-authority links?
Quality always beats quantity. A single link from a high-authority, pertinent site like The New York Times or TechCrunch can be more beneficial than hundreds of links from obscure, low-traffic blogs.
3. Does an agency guarantee specific rankings?
Ethical SEO agencies do not ensure # 1 rankings since they do not manage the search engine algorithms. Instead, they focus on enhancing the website's authority and visibility gradually through tested methods.
4. What is the difference between follow and no-follow links?

A "no-follow" link tells online search engine not to associate the authority of the source with the destination. While do-follow links are the primary goal, a natural link profile need to consist of a mix of both.
5. Why is link structure more costly than other SEO tasks?
Link structure is resource-intensive. It needs proficient scientists, professional authors, and outreach experts who need to spend hours developing relationships with editors and web designers.
